#1b51bc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1b51bc is composed of 10.6% red, 31.8% green and 73.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.6% cyan, 56.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 26.3% black. It has a hue angle of 219.9 degrees, a saturation of 74.9% and a lightness of 42.2%. #1b51bc color hex could be obtained by blending #36a2ff with #000079.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

Shades and Tints of #1b51bc
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020710 is the darkest color, while #feff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1b51bc
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#656972 is the less saturated color, while #0249d5 is the most saturated one.
